Download Solution PDFEight labourers working 10 hours a day completed a work in 18 days. If only 5 labourers are working, then in how many hours a day should they work to finish the work in 24 days?

Detailed Solution
Download Solution PDFGiven:
Number of labourers working initially = 8
Hours per day worked initially = 10
Days taken initially = 18
Number of labourers working later = 5
Days taken later = 24
Formula Used:
Total Work = Number of Labourers × Hours per day × Days
Calculation:
Total Work (initial) = 8 × 10 × 18
Total Work (initial) = 1440 hours
Total Work (later) = 5 × Hours per day × 24
Since Total Work (initial) = Total Work (later)
1440 = 5 × Hours per day × 24
⇒ Hours per day = 1440 / (5 × 24)
⇒ Hours per day = 1440 / 120
⇒ Hours per day = 12
The correct answer is option 4 i.e. 12 hours.
